The core difference between KACE Unified Endpoint Manager and IBM MaaS360 is that KACE is designed for medium to large businesses without a specific target audience, while IBM MaaS360 is tailored for large enterprises that require scalable, AI-driven management solutions. Ideal buyers for KACE are medium to large organizations looking for endpoint management, whereas IBM MaaS360 is best suited for large enterprises in various sectors needing robust security and device management capabilities.
- Suitable for medium to large businesses - Focuses on endpoint management - Lacks specific target audience - Flexible deployment options - User-friendly interface - Comprehensive device management features
- Best for large enterprises - Scalable and AI-driven management - Ideal for diverse sectors like healthcare and finance - Provides AI-powered threat intelligence - Automates security recommendations - Supports management of hundreds of thousands of devices

Reasons buyers look elsewhere
No alternatives guidance available yet.
- IBM MaaS360 offers a robust set of features, but users unfamiliar with mobile device management (MDM) may find the interface complex and overwhelming initially compared to more user-friendly platforms like Jamf or Microsoft Intune.
- Some users report limitations in customizing reports and dashboards, which can be restrictive for organizations needing advanced analytics or tailored compliance reporting.
- While pricing is flexible, IBM MaaS360 can become expensive for larger enterprises or those requiring advanced modules, leading some to prefer alternatives like SOTI MobiControl or ManageEngine with more favorable pricing tiers.
